Cedar tree removal services involve the careful and efficient process of removing mature cedar trees from residential or commercial properties. These professionals use specialized equipment and techniques to safely cut, dismantle, and clear away cedar trees that may be posing a risk or no longer serve the property’s needs. The work often includes assessing the tree’s health and stability, planning the safest way to remove it, and ensuring that the surrounding landscape remains undamaged. This service is essential for maintaining a safe environment and preventing potential hazards caused by falling branches or unstable trees.
Removing cedar trees can help solve a variety of problems that homeowners and property managers may encounter. Overgrown or damaged cedars can become safety hazards, especially during storms or high winds when branches might break or the entire tree could fall. Additionally, trees that are diseased or infested with pests may need to be removed to protect nearby plants and trees. Cedar removal can also be part of a landscape redesign, clearing space for new construction, or improving visibility and sunlight for lawns and gardens. Addressing these issues promptly with professional help can prevent more costly repairs or safety concerns down the line.

The overview below groups typical Cedar Tree Removal projects into broad ranges so you can see how smaller, mid-sized, and larger jobs often compare in Hendersonville, NC.
In many markets, a large share of routine jobs stays in the lower and middle ranges, while only a smaller percentage of projects moves into the highest bands when the work is more complex or site conditions are harder than average.
Smaller Tree Removals - For routine tree removal projects involving small to medium-sized trees, local contractors typically charge between $250 and $600. Many common jobs fall within this range, especially for trees under 30 feet tall. Larger or more complex small jobs can sometimes reach higher prices, but they are less frequent.
Medium-Sized Tree Removal - Removing trees that are 30 to 60 feet tall usually costs between $600 and $1,500. This range covers most standard projects in Hendersonville and surrounding areas. Projects exceeding this size or with special challenges may push costs above $2,000.
Larger Tree Removal - For trees taller than 60 feet, costs generally range from $1,500 to $3,500. Many of these larger jobs are straightforward, but more intricate removals with nearby structures or difficult access can increase the price significantly.
Full Tree Replacement - When a tree removal is part of a landscape redesign or requires full replacement, costs can vary widely from $2,000 to over $5,000. Larger, more complex projects involving multiple trees and extensive site work tend to fall into the higher end of this spectrum.
Actual totals will depend on details like access to the work area, the scope of the project, and the materials selected, so use these as general starting points rather than exact figures.
